Is it possible for a new LLC in Colorado to obtain business loans?

Yes, a newly formed LLC in Colorado can pursue business loans, though lenders will meticulously examine projected revenues, the expertise of the management team, and the availability of collateral. The absence of historical financial data necessitates a robust presentation of future potential.

What factors influence the monthly payment on a fifty thousand dollar business loan in Colorado?

The monthly payment for a fifty thousand dollar business loan in Colorado is primarily dictated by the interest rate, the loan term (repayment period), and any associated fees. These elements are directly influenced by the lender's risk assessment and the broader economic conditions prevailing in the state.

Can I apply for an SBA $10,000 grant for my business in Colorado?

SBA funding is predominantly offered as loans requiring repayment, not as direct grants. While direct grants are exceptionally rare, the SBA provides a variety of loan programs that can furnish substantial capital for Colorado businesses, thereby supporting their operational and growth initiatives.
